Clwb Ifor Bach in Cardiff under threat

Help

Amongst Cardiff's night life is one club that for the past 30 years has stood out as a distinct venue for the Welsh-speaking community: Clwb Ifor Bach - known to many as the Welsh club.

But now the venue is under threat.

The trustees and secretary are standing down this year and they say if they cannot find people to replace them who will uphold the values the club was founded upon it could end up closing it down or sold to the highest bidder.
